10 AI Predictions for the Next 12 Months — State of AI 2023
By Nathan Benaich and Air Street Capital team
2 min readOct 17, 2023
I love tech predictions. Nathan and his team has done a great job of predicting this year’s AI wave.
Here are their predictions for the next 12 months:
- A Hollywood-grade production makes use of generative AI for visual effects.
- A generative AI media company is investigated for its misuse during in the 2024 US election circuit.
- Self-improving AI agents crush SOTA in a complex environment (e.g. AAA game, tool use, science).
- Tech IPO markets unthaw and we see at least one major listing for an AI-focused company (e.g. Databricks).
- The GenAI scaling craze sees a group spend >$1B to train a single large-scale model.
- The US’s FTC or UK’s CMA investigate the Microsoft/OpenAI deal on competition grounds.
- We see limited progress on global AI governance beyond high-level voluntary commitments.
- Financial institutions launch GPU debt funds to replace VC equity dollars for compute funding.
- An AI-generated song breaks into the Billboard Hot 100 Top 10 or the Spotify Top Hits 2024.
- As inference workloads and costs grow significantly, a large AI company (e.g. OpenAI) acquires an inference-focused AI chip company.
